What Makes a Browser Private?

A private browser prioritizes user privacy and data security, offering features that minimize tracking and enhance anonymity online.

  • No Tracking: Many private browsers do not track user activity or collect data to create user profiles, ensuring that browsing history remains confidential.
  • Default Encryption: Private browsers often come with built-in encryption protocols, which protect data exchanged between the user and websites, making it harder for third parties to intercept information.
  • Ad and Tracker Blockers: These browsers frequently include tools to block ads and trackers that can follow users across the web, further enhancing privacy by limiting unwanted surveillance.
  • Anonymous Browsing Mode: Most private browsers feature an incognito or private mode that does not save browsing history, cookies, or site data after the session ends, providing an additional layer of privacy.
  • VPN Integration: Some private browsers offer integrated VPN services that mask the user’s IP address, adding another level of anonymity and allowing access to content that may be restricted based on geographic location.
  • Minimalist Design: A focus on simplicity and minimalism helps reduce distractions and encourages secure browsing habits, often eliminating unnecessary features that might compromise privacy.

By implementing these features, private browsers aim to create a safer and more secure online experience for users concerned about their privacy.

Why is VPN Integration Important for Privacy?

VPN integration is crucial for enhancing online privacy as it offers multiple layers of security that a standalone private browser cannot provide. Here are some key reasons why incorporating a VPN is beneficial:

  • Data Encryption: A VPN encrypts your internet traffic, making it nearly impossible for third parties, including ISPs and hackers, to monitor your online activities. This encryption secures personal information sent over public networks.

  • IP Address Masking: By connecting to a VPN server, your real IP address is hidden, allowing you to browse anonymously. This prevents websites from tracking your location and building a profile based on your browsing habits.

  • Access to Restricted Content: VPNs enable users to bypass geographical restrictions on content, providing access to websites and services that may be unavailable in certain regions.

  • Enhanced Security on Public Wi-Fi: Using a private browser alone does not protect against threats on unsecured Wi-Fi networks. A VPN safeguards data on such networks, reducing the risk of interception by cybercriminals.

  • Avoiding Bandwidth Throttling: Some ISPs throttle internet speeds based on user activity. A VPN helps to prevent this by obscuring your online behavior, ensuring consistent performance.

By integrating a VPN with a private browser, users achieve a more secure and private online experience.

How Does Tor Browser Ensure Maximum Privacy?

Tor Browser employs several techniques to ensure maximum privacy for its users.

  • Onion Routing: Tor uses a method called onion routing, where data is encrypted and sent through a series of randomly selected servers (nodes) before reaching its final destination. This multi-layered encryption makes it difficult for anyone to trace the origin of the data, preserving user anonymity.
  • No Tracking: Unlike traditional browsers, Tor does not track user activity or store browsing history. All sessions are ephemeral, meaning that once you close the browser, no trace of your activity is left on the device.
  • IP Address Masking: When using Tor, your real IP address is hidden from the websites you visit. Instead, the websites see the IP address of the last Tor node, which helps in preventing tracking and profiling based on your location.
  • HTTPS Everywhere: Tor Browser integrates HTTPS Everywhere, which automatically switches websites from HTTP to HTTPS where available. This ensures that your connection to websites is encrypted, adding an additional layer of security against eavesdropping.
  • No Script Support: The browser comes with NoScript functionality, which blocks scripts that can potentially compromise your privacy. This feature prevents malicious scripts from running, which could otherwise expose your data or track your activities across the web.
  • Regular Updates: Tor Browser is regularly updated to patch vulnerabilities and enhance privacy features. Keeping the software up-to-date ensures users benefit from the latest security measures and fixes against potential exploits.

Why is Mozilla Firefox a Strong Privacy-Focused Choice?

Mozilla Firefox is considered a strong privacy-focused choice because it prioritizes user data protection and offers robust privacy features that limit tracking and data collection.

According to the Electronic Frontier Foundation (EFF), Firefox includes advanced tracking protection by default, blocking third-party trackers and enhancing users’ ability to control their online presence (EFF, 2021). Additionally, Mozilla has a transparent approach regarding data collection, making it clear how user data is handled and allowing users to customize their privacy settings.

The underlying mechanism of Firefox’s privacy features lies in its commitment to open-source development, enabling external audits and community contributions that enhance security. This transparent development process fosters trust among users, as they can verify the integrity of the browser and its features. Furthermore, features like Enhanced Tracking Protection utilize machine learning to identify and block known trackers, reducing the likelihood of user data being shared without consent. This combination of transparency, user control, and innovative technology contributes to Firefox’s reputation as one of the best private browsers for desktop users.

What Should You Consider When Choosing a Private Browser?

When choosing the best private browser for desktop use, several key factors should be considered to ensure optimal privacy and security.

  • Privacy Features: Look for a browser that offers built-in privacy features such as ad-blocking, tracker blocking, and anti-fingerprinting technology. These features help minimize the amount of data collected about your browsing habits and enhance your anonymity online.
  • Data Encryption: A good private browser should provide strong encryption methods for data transmission, ensuring that your online activities are secure from eavesdropping. This is particularly important when accessing sensitive information or using public Wi-Fi networks.
  • User Interface and Experience: The browser should have a user-friendly interface that allows for easy navigation while maintaining privacy settings. A complicated interface may deter users from utilizing privacy features effectively.
  • Open Source vs. Proprietary: Consider whether the browser is open-source or proprietary, as open-source browsers often allow for greater transparency and community scrutiny regarding security practices. This can lead to more robust privacy protections over time.
  • Compatibility with Extensions: Check if the browser supports privacy-enhancing extensions, such as VPNs or additional ad blockers, which can further bolster your online privacy. Compatibility with a wide range of extensions allows users to customize their browsing experience according to their needs.
  • Performance and Speed: Assess the browser’s performance in terms of speed and resource usage, as a private browser should not significantly compromise your browsing speed while providing enhanced privacy features. A balance between security and performance is essential for a satisfactory user experience.
  • Regular Updates and Support: Choose a browser that receives regular updates to address security vulnerabilities and improve features. Continuous support from the developers is crucial for maintaining a secure browsing environment.

What Additional Privacy Measures Can Enhance Your Experience?

To enhance your privacy while browsing, consider the following additional measures:

  • VPN (Virtual Private Network): A VPN encrypts your internet connection and masks your IP address, making it difficult for third parties to track your online activities. By routing your connection through a server in a different location, it adds an extra layer of privacy, especially on public Wi-Fi networks.
  • Ad Blockers: Ad blockers prevent unwanted advertisements from appearing while you browse, which can also help minimize tracking by advertisers. Many ads employ cookies and tracking scripts that compromise your privacy, so removing them can enhance your browsing experience.
  • Privacy-Focused Search Engines: Using search engines that do not track or store your search history, such as DuckDuckGo or Startpage, can significantly improve your privacy. These search engines prioritize user anonymity and don’t collect personal data, unlike traditional search engines.
  • Browser Extensions for Privacy: Extensions like HTTPS Everywhere and Privacy Badger can enhance your privacy by ensuring secure connections and blocking trackers. They work seamlessly with your browser to enforce encryption and prevent data collection without your consent.
  • Regularly Clear Cookies and Cache: Clearing your browser’s cookies and cache regularly can help reduce the amount of data that websites store about you. This practice minimizes tracking and can help maintain a cleaner and more private browsing experience.
  • Use Incognito or Private Browsing Modes: Most browsers offer an incognito or private mode that doesn’t save your browsing history or cookies after the session ends. While this doesn’t make you completely anonymous, it does prevent local tracking on your device.
  • Secure Your Home Network: Ensuring that your home Wi-Fi network is secure with strong passwords and encryption can prevent unauthorized access. This helps protect your browsing activity from being intercepted by outsiders, giving you more peace of mind.
  • Two-Factor Authentication (2FA): Enabling 2FA on your accounts adds an additional layer of security, making it harder for unauthorized users to gain access. Even if someone obtains your password, they would still need the second factor to log in.
